Sweet potato paratha/sweet potato roti/chapathi/Cilagaḍadumpa roti with step by step instructions

Sweet potatoes paratha/sweet potatoes Chapathi with step by step instructions

Highly Nutritious, Sweet potatoes are starchy root vegetables that are rich in fibre, vitamins, and minerals. They’re also high in antioxidants that protect your body from free radical damage and chronic disease.

Benefits of sweet potatoes:

  1. Promote Gut Health, Sweet potatoes contain fiber and antioxidants that promote the growth of good gut bacteria and contribute to a healthy gut.
  2. It Supports Your Immune System, Sweet potatoes are an excellent source of beta carotene, which can be converted to vitamin A and help support your immune system and gut health.
  3. It Supports Healthy Vision, Sweet potatoes are rich in beta-carotene and anthocyanins, antioxidants that may help prevent vision loss and improve eye health.

Animal studies proven are:

  • Cancer-fighting properties, Animal studies have proven that sweet potatoes have anthocyanins and other antioxidants, which may have cancer-fighting properties. But human studies are needed.
  • Enhance Brain function, Animal studies have shown that sweet potatoes may improve brain health by reducing inflammation and preventing mental decline. However, it remains unknown whether they have the same effects in humans.

Ingredients:

  1. 5 boiled sweet potatoes
  2. 1 tsp jeera powder
  3. ½ tsp turmeric powder
  4. 1 tsp coriander powder
  5. ½ tsp hing
  6. Salt to taste
  7. A handful of coriander leaves
  8. 1 cup wheat flour
  9. 4 tsp oil
  10. 30 ml water


Preparation of sweet potatoes paratha with step by step instructions:

  1. Take boiled sweet potatoes to a mixing bowl
  2. Add jeera powder, turmeric powder, coriander powder, hing and salt as per taste
  3. Add coriander leaves and combine everything by mashing the sweet potatoes
  4. Add wheat flour slowly don't add at a time, add according to the dough
  5. If required add water, Knead like a dough
  6. Add oil to the dough and knead it, and rest it for 5 minutes
  7. Take dough into pieces and make small balls according to the size of the paratha
  8. Spread loose wheat flour to the chapati board and roll it with the help of a rolling pin
  9. By sprinkle wheat flour roll it has a Chapathi
  10. Heat the Chapati pan 
  11. Place the rolled paratha in the pan and cook for a while and turn another side and spread the oil to it
  12. And turn another side and apply to it, turn another side and cook
  13. That's it, remove from the pan and serve hot.
  14. You can serve with dal or curd, here I am serving with dal


Another method for paratha:

  1. Before adding wheat flour take mixture as stuff for paratha
  2. Knead the wheat flour as a Chapati dough.
  3. Roll the dough and keep the sweet potatoes stuff to it and roll the paratha
  4. That it cook the paratha like Chapati
